A vibrant town outside of London

Situated in Kent County just 21 miles southeast of London is the charming and attractive town of Sevenoaks. The town is served by a commuter main line railway which goes directly to London, and as such, is remarkably easy to reach from London. Sevenoaks is characterized by historic country houses, green parks, gardens, and walking paths. It’s peaceful, laid-back atmosphere offers a pleasant break from the bustle of the big city. The area and getting around

Arriving in Sevenoaks

If you’ll be arriving by aeroplane, the nearest airports are London City Airport and London Gatwick Airport, both of which are less than 20 miles away from Sevenoaks. Getting to and from London is easy via the South Eastern Trains Service which departs from London Bridge and arrives in Sevenoaks in 44 minutes. You can also use a taxi or drive yourself with a private vehicle or a car hire.

Getting around Sevenoaks

Unless it’s your preference, it is not necessary to have a private car during your holiday in Sevenoaks. Public transportation services are widely available here and the town itself is very walkable, with nearly all attractions reachable on foot. You can easily rely on walking, cycling, public transportation such as buses or trains, or taxis during your holiday here.

Sevenoaks is believed to have been established around 800 AD and was named after seven trees which had stood in the town centre.

Top 5 travel tips in Sevenoaks

1. Explore the lovely country house and park at Knole

This National Trust site is one of the town’s most popular attractions. Knole is an enormous medieval country house dating back to the mid-1400s. The architectural masterpiece boasts seven courtyards, opulent rooms, and endless incredible detailed work. Tour the lavish interior of the house and then enjoy a leisurely stroll around the stunning gardens. The popular and vast Knole Park boasts wonderful walking trails, plenty of deer, and lovely scenery where you can enjoy walks in nature. There’s a nice on-site café here serving soups, salads, and sandwiches.

2. Visit the impressive Ightham Mote mansion

Another popular National Trust site in Sevenoaks is Ightham Mote, an incredible medieval half-timbered mansion surrounded by a mote. The romantic architectural style of the house was originally designed for Henry VIII in the 16th century. Tour the incredible 70+ rooms of the home which are situated around a large courtyard area. The friendly, knowledgable staff are more than happy to offer interesting titbits of information about the home as well. There’s a great café here, as well as a souvenir and bookshop.

3. Enjoy breathtaking views of the countryside at Riverhill Himalayan Gardens

These vibrant gardens showcase different various themed gardens in a countryside setting. Visit a Himalayan-themed garden with exotic plants, a hedge maze, a lake, fountains, and more. Have a long leisurely stroll along the walking path to discover all the unique features of the grounds. There are plenty of benches where you can have a rest, and a lovely café if you’re feeling peckish.

4. Go for a peaceful walk at the Emmetts Garden

This quaint National Trust site boasts spectacular views which will instantly make you forget about any of your life’s stresses. Enjoy a peaceful walk along the paths as you pass along fountains, colourful flowers, fairy-houses, woodlands, and rose gardens. If you go during the spring months, you’ll get to see a breathtaking display of daffodils, tulips, and bluebells. There’s a lovely café here serving nice scones, coffee, tea, soups, and more!

5. Visit the lavender fields at Castle Farm

If you find yourself in Sevenoaks during the summer months, pop over to the neighbouring town of Shoreham where you can visit the incredible bright purple lavender fields at Castle Farm. These picturesque, sweet-smelling flower fields are truly a breathtaking sight to behold. Snap some photos, stroll through the floral-scented purple lanes, and admire the countryside scenery. There is a lovely farm shop here where you can purchase farm fresh products such as produce, meats, lavender, oils, honey, juices, and tea.
